CHANDIGARH: Former Chief Minister Capt Amarinder Singh on Monday asked the Deputy Chief Minister Sukhbir Singh Badal to be concerned about the welfare of the state rather than maintaining his time table. Taunting Sukhbir, he remarked, “You manufacture myths and invent facts to buy these yourself and cry hoarse only to cut a sorry figure at the end”.
Reacting to Sukhbir’s statement about his Sunday morning meeting with people at Amritsar, Capt Amarinder retorted, “I feel good that you are so much concerned about what I do and what I don’t and what time I get up and what time I come out and that is why I am telling you that you are not fit for the job because Chief Ministers and Deputy Chief Ministers are supposed to do better things than be obsessive time keepers of their political opponents”.
He remarked, “If the states’ defacto Chief Minister is so much obsessed with my time table and it remains his top most priority one can well understand why Punjab is sliding towards financial and administrative anarchy”. About his meeting with morning walkers, the former Chief Minister asked Sukhbir to check his facts. “You better check your facts as I never said I had gone for a morning walk but meeting people”, he asserted, while adding, “Yes, I had gone to meet people there in the Company Bagh and if you have problem with my getting properly dressed I really can’t help it because I can’t toss my turban like your father to be seen as a helpless and tired man always pretending to be toiling around”. “And don’t be bothered about by inaccessibility leave that to my workers and people of Amritsar as I think they are better judges”, he told Sukhbir., while adding, “If you have any doubts ask Jaitley, who had the first-hand experience on Sunday morning”.
